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Cost Calculator Builder versions prior to 4.0.2
Description The plugin is susceptible to Unauthenticated Price Manipulation and Insecure Direct Object Reference (IDOR), which occurs when used in combination with Cost Calculator Builder PRO. The issue arises because the 'ccb woocommerce payment' AJAX action is registered via wp ajax nopriv, allowing unauthenticated access. Additionally, the renderWooCommercePayment() function passes user-controlled data to CCBWooCheckout::init() without performing authorization checks. This allows unauthenticated attackers to add WooCommerce products to their cart with prices they control.
Recommendations Update to a version later than 4.0.1. As a temporary workaround, restrict access to the 'ccb woocommerce payment' AJAX action to authenticated users only.
